Output e2d291cead6e72302d7207b741215d2e3ee192e8b4c863d63f452882013f7914:1

value
67480322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e660867a5749772b8a2ab288c0094271b3de8b67 OP_EQUAL
address
3Nh8yMrsDXbdaeCLLnenFjbybfYQMBJHXC
transaction
e2d291cead6e72302d7207b741215d2e3ee192e8b4c863d63f452882013f7914
confirmations
251685
spent
true